What is EMS?

EMS, also known as Electric Muscle Stimulation, is the process that uses external electrical charge or pulse to cause muscle contractions. This pulse is created by the EMS machine or device. The electrodes are placed on the skin and the electric charge is transferred to the muscle to trigger contraction.

The EMS provides muscle relief by stimulating the inflamed muscles. The units are designed in such a way that they can treat swelling and pain by putting strain on the muscles as well as its supporting joints. Many doctors and physical therapists recommend using EMS units to help them achieve muscular pain relief. They are very helpful in treating spasms as well as edema that are known to be the leading cause of muscle loss and discomfort.

Some physical therapists also recommend EMS units to stimulate blood circulation. That is because they are able to release tension in muscles and also treat stiffness in joints. They are particularly helpful in working the neck as well as the back area that suffer the most due to tension in the rest of the body.

What is TENS?

TENS, also known as transcutaneous electrical nerve stimulation, are designed to provide relief by sending painless impulses through the skin to the nerves below. The electronic stimulation eliminates pain that a person may feel due to chronic health condition or a nerve disorder.

The pain therapy offered by TENS can provide pain relief without the use of medication. The electrical pulses trigger the nerve endings to create endorphins that eliminate the pain signals. TENS units work as a distraction mechanism by stimulating the pulses that takes your mind off the pain and keep pain signals from reaching your brain. Simply put, these units work towards creating your very own painkillers, also known as endorphins, that make you feel relaxed after a treatment.

It is mainly used in case of acute pain, pain after surgery, post-operative incision pain, migraines, tension headaches, cancer pain etc.
